For those sport and technical divers who like a wrist-watch form factor suitable for everyday wear, the Garmin Descent Mk2s builds on the features of their fēnix® 6s multi-activity smartwatch to add SCUBA diving functionality. The Descent series includes mixed-gas decompression dive computer functionality in a premium smartwatch with activity profiles, performance metrics and smart notifications. The Descent high-resolution transflective memory-in-pixel (MIP) display with LED back light assures readability in all dive conditions including bright sunlight.

Once underwater, the Bühlmann ZHL-16C decompression algorithm with user configurable Gradient Factors allows individual control of your dive computer decompression calculations and stop depths. Full color graphics plus tone and vibration alerts help keep you informed while you’re submerged. During a decompression dive, the Descent can provide time-to-surface based on "look ahead" at planned gas switches along with current ceiling and stop time. Multiple gas definition presets are supported with any combination of air, nitrox, trimix and oxygen. For technical dives, the Descent is user configurable to NOT "lockout" after a missed stop. Even underwater (if worn next to the skin), the Descent is able to measure and display your actual heartbeat rate.

On land, the Descent also functions as a robust training and outdoor companion. It has profiles for running, cycling, swimming, as well as indoor workouts and recreational activities such as boating, golf, hiking, climbing, skiing and much more. Pinpoint navigation and topographic mapping (on the surface only) using both GPS and GLONASS satellite signals. Thanks to built-in Bluetooth, it supports notifications from a paired smartphone. It's also Wi-Fi enabled to connect and automatically send activity uploads, including your dive logs, for review or sharing on Garmin Connect. Store up to 2,000 songs, or access streaming music apps from your compatible services, including Spotify®, Deezer and Amazon Music. What’s more, the Descent design is suitable for wear as your everyday timepiece.

Diving Features, Functions and Alerts Highlights:

  • Decompression dive computer with {1.2 inch | 30.4 mm} color display in a richly featured multi-activity smartwatch
  • Built-in sensors include depth, temperature, 3-axis compass, gyroscope, barometric altimeter and heart rate with pulse oximeter
  • Supports open-circuit single-gas, multi-gas, closed-circuit rebreather (CCR), gauge and apnea (free-diving) modes
  • Plan your dives directly on the device, including planned deco with gas switches
  • Supports a bottom gas plus up to 5 decompression/backup gas mixes including air, nitrox, trimix and 100% oxygen
  • Bühlmann ZHL-16c algorithm with configurable Gradient Factors
  • GF presets for sport diving NDL safety factor: High = 35/75, Medium = 40/85, Low = 45/95
  • Depth rated to { 330 fsw | 100 msw }, designed to comply with EN13319
  • Various alerts (tone, vibration, display) for:

    • CNS Warning >= 80% and CNS Critical >= 100%
    • OTU Warning >= 250 and OTU Critical >= 300
    • NDL Warning >= 80% of inert gas limit and NDL Exceeded
    • PO2 Low < 0.18 ATA (suppressed first two minutes of dive)
    • PO2 High and PO2 Critical (user configurable up to 1.6 ATA)
    • Ascent rate fast >= {30 fpm | 10 mpm} for >= 10 seconds
    • Gas switch suggested (based on enabled gas list and selected switch PO2)
    • Approaching deco stop, deco stop completed and all deco complete
    • Depth Ceiling violation if above ceiling by {2.0 ft | 0.6 m}
    • Multiple user configurable depth and runtime alerts
    • User configurable safety stop
    • User configurable units: imperial (feet, psi) or metric (meters, bar)
    • Battery Low < 20% and Battery Critical < 10%
  • Missed deco lockout can be disabled prior or post dive with user acknowledgement
  • On device dive log lets you store and review data from up to 200 dives
  • Store and share unlimited dive log online via Garmin Connect™ and its included mobile app
  • Bluetooth Smart, Wi-Fi and ANT+ supports wireless connectivity to a variety of devices as well as firmware updates.
  • Battery life: Varies depending on features enabled - Dive mode: Up to 30 hours, Smartwatch Mode: Up to 7 days, Battery Saver Watch Mode: Up to 21 days. Enabling the GPS substantially impacts battery life - GPS: Up to 18 hours, GPS + Music: Up to 6 hours, Max Battery GPS Mode: Up to 32 hours
  • Construction material is a fiber-reinforced polymer body with sapphire crystal lens and stainless steel bezel with diamond like color coating (DLC); includes silicone wrist band
  • Physical case size is {1.69 x 1.69 x 0.56 inch} or {43 x 43 x 14.15 mm}

Garmin Descent Mk2/Mk2i/Mk2s Model Differences

Mk2 vs Mk2s Comparison

For those sport and technical divers who like a wrist-watch form factor suitable for everyday wear, the Garmin Descent builds on the features of their premium multi-activity GPS smartwatches to add SCUBA diving functionality.

  • The Garmin Descent series is based on their fēnix® multi-activity smartwatch adding sport and technical SCUBA diving functionality that includes support for mixed gases including Nitrox and Trimix. The Mk2 and Mk2i models are both based on the largest fēnix® 6X and the Mk2s model is based on the smallest fēnix® 6s.
  • The Mk2 and Mk2i are larger than the Mk2s in over all size (52x52x18 vs 43x43x14 mm) and weight (104 vs 60 grams) with a wider wristband (26 vs 20 mm). The displays of the Mk2 and Mk2i offer 36% more viewing area (1.4 vs 1.2 inch diameter) and higher resolution (280x280 vs 240x240 pixels).
  • The larger physical case size of the Mk2 and Mk2i enables them to have a higher capacity battery. Depending on the features enabled, the Mk2 and Mk2i have slightly more than double the battery life of the Mk2s.
  • The top-of-the-line Mk2i model adds support for their SubWave™ sonar data network which can share real time data — such as remaining dive time, gas consumption rate and more — while underwater during the dive between you and other Mk2i divers with {33 feet | 10 meters}.
  • The MK2i model also supports hoseless gas cylinder pressure integration, sometimes called air integration (AI), with up to five (5) separately purchased optional Descent T1 Tank Pod wireless pressure transmitters. No other Garmin Descent model (without the little 'i') supports AI. Mk2 vs Mk2s Comparison
  • The only other significant differences between the Garmin Descent models are their cosmetics, especially bezel materials and colors. Garmin sometimes offers bundles with specific accessory packages such as different wrist bands, but the core Descent features remain as described above.
